mysql数据库
林先生拆坑日记。
努力做个合格的程序员!
展开
-
mysql timestamp 时间戳 用法 和一些处理
好久没更新博客了 , 最近都在干项目, 总结一下项目中 timestamp 遇到的问题。 Unix时间戳(Unix timestamp),或称Unix时间(Unix time)、POSIX时间(POSIX time),是一种时间表示方式,定义为从格林威治时间1970年01月01日00时00分00秒起至现在的总秒数。 1. timestamp 设置默认值 CURRENT_TIMESTAMP (增加数...原创 2019-09-12 10:20:14 · 484 阅读 · 0 评论 -
SQL语句优化
1.select子句中尽量避免使用* *表示全部查找全部数据 如果数据库数据量很大的话 你只能够看着屏幕发呆了! 另外,如果select * 用于多表联结,会造成更大的成本开销。 2.使用where 避免在where左侧出现运算 表达式 函数等 因为这样会导致全表扫描 例如 where age+1 >17 优化方法: here age > 17 -1 所以,为了提高效率,wher...原创 2019-12-09 10:45:44 · 73 阅读 · 0 评论 -
数据库 查询笔试题
题目数据 要求查询结果为: 使用连接: 结果: SELECT t1.time,t1.win,t2.false FROM (SELECT TIME ,COUNT(result) AS win FROM DATE WHERE result='win' GROUP BY TIME )AS t1 LEFT JOIN (SELECT TIME ,COUNT(result) AS 'false...原创 2019-10-03 01:03:58 · 291 阅读 · 0 评论